But the exposed eyes are very clear and bright, the small and straight nose, the slightly pursed lips...
"If this little boy washes his face clean and puts on clean clothes, he will definitely be a handsome boy." Ping'er murmured.
Huahua asked Pinger: "Auntie, is he a beggar? Is he also an orphan whose parents didn't want him?"
Ping'er shook her head, "It doesn't look like a beggar, but it's definitely a child of a poor family."
Huahua said: "That little brother looks so pitiful, he seems to be very hungry, he really wants to eat the buns there!"
"Auntie, shall we help him?"
Ping'er nodded, and recruited a guy who came to pay the bill, "The two meat buns are for the kid at the door, and I will pay for them."
The man went over to get the buns, pointed at Ping'er, and said a few words to the child.
The little boy turned his head and looked towards Ping'er, with surprise in his big eyes.
Ping'er stood up, smiled softly at the little boy, took Huahua's hand, and was about to walk over to say hello to the boy,
The child turned around and ran away with the bun in his hands.
"This little brother really doesn't have a tutor. We kindly invited him to eat steamed stuffed buns, but we ran away without even saying a word of thanks, making us seem like bad people!"
Ping'er and Huahua chased to the door of the shop, looking at the direction in which the little boy ran away, Huahua said a little unhappy.
But Ping'er smiled forgivingly, and said: "That child may be afraid of life, forget it, let him go, we are leaving too."
Huahua nodded, followed Pinger into the carriage waiting at the gate, and headed towards the north gate of Yuncheng.
When the carriage drove slowly, at the entrance of the alley next to the shop, the figure of the little boy reappeared.
He looked curiously at the receding carriage, and then lowered his head to look at the two meat buns in his hand.
Then he grabbed one of the buns and took a bite, tilting his head thoughtfully.
In the alley behind him, two shadow figures quietly appeared behind him.
The little boy looked sideways slightly, the childlike innocence and curiosity in his eyes had long since disappeared, replaced by depth and calmness.
"The next target has been found, which is the carriage that just left." He said.
"You stay in Yuncheng and wait for me. You don't need to follow me. I'll come back to meet you when I'm done."
After saying this, he slipped and disappeared around the corner of the street.
In the alley, the two black figures were a little at a loss.
"Little master, what are you going to play here? Every day, come and go without a trace." One of them said.
Another said: "In the words of the little master himself, this is called playing different roles to experience life."
The person before said again: "When I left the East China Sea, I agreed to come out to gain knowledge and wander the rivers and lakes? This day-to-day experience of life, playing the role of a beggar today, an orphan tomorrow, and a problem child the day after tomorrow, my brain is all over. not understand……"
"It doesn't matter whether we understand or not, as long as the little master is having fun." Another person said again.
"Then shall we still follow?"
"Nonsense, we must follow. The master sent us two to protect the little master's safety. We must not show up unless it is absolutely necessary, and we must not interfere with the little master's affairs, but the little master must be in our sight."
"Why don't you hurry up and chase him? He ran out of the city early..."
The two of them circulated their skills between their feet again, turning into two black whirlwinds and chasing after the city gate...
……
"Aunt Ping, look, that little boy!"
Huahua suddenly pointed to a figure outside the carriage, and said loudly to Ping'er.
Ping'er was surprised, "It's really him!"
"Aunt Ping, he seems to be leaving the city too!" Huahua said again.
Ping'er nodded, and when the carriage passed by the little boy, the little boy stopped and sat on the side of the road.
He took off his worn-out shoes, knocked sand on the ground, and rubbed his little feet there, wrinkling his little face into a little bitter gourd.
"Stop." Ping'er told the driver.
The carriage stopped, and Ping'er got out of the car with Hua Hua and came to the side of the road, squatting down in front of the little boy.
"Little brother, can we help you with anything?" Ping'er asked.
The little boy raised his head and looked at Ping'er, his extremely beautiful eyes showed the child's fear.
Ping'er smiled softly: "Don't be afraid, I'm not a bad person."
Pinger's eyes fell on the little boy's cry again: "What's wrong with your feet?"
The little boy lowered his eyes and said in a low voice, "I ran too fast earlier and twisted.",
Ping'er said, "Did you twist your foot? Show me."
The little boy shrank his feet and asked Ping'er in a low voice: "Auntie, can you push your feet?"
Ping'er was stunned, yes, I don't know how to push my feet, it's useless to read.
"Then what can I do for you?" Ping'er asked again.
"Can I take you to the hospital?" She asked again.
The little boy shook his head, "My grandfather is a doctor in the village, he can push feet. Can Auntie take me for a ride?"
Pinger smiled and nodded, "Of course, where is your home?"
The little boy pointed to the outside of the north city gate, "Put me down at the foot of the mountain ahead..."
Ping'er carried the little boy into the carriage, and in the carriage, Huahua took out her own snacks for the little boy to eat.
"Little brother, I'll eat for you." Huahua smiled and winked at the little boy.
The little boy looked at the little sister who was not a few years older than him, and took her snacks, "Thank you, sister."
Huahua smiled, and wanted to touch the little boy's head like a little adult, but the little boy avoided it cleverly.
"Sister's snacks are delicious." He said.
Huahua smiled, "If you like it, I'll just give it to you."
She gave all the big bag of snacks to the little boy.
The little boy had a flattered look on his face, and he didn't rush to pick it up, but looked at Ping'er who was sitting there embroidering.
Ping'er smiled lovingly at the little boy, "Huahua gave it to you, just keep it and eat it slowly when you get home."
The little boy just accepted it.
Huahua was curious about the little boy all the way, but the little boy secretly looked at Ping'er curiously.
Ping'er seemed to have noticed something, looked up at him, smiled and said, "Why are you peeking at me so much?"
The little boy said, "Look at Auntie's embroidery."
Ping'er smiled and said, "Does your mother also embroider?"
When asked this question, the little boy's face suddenly showed sadness.
He shook his head and said, "I don't know,"
"I don't know if my mother embroiders or not. I have never seen my mother's face since I was born."
"Ah?" Ping'er was surprised, stopped what she was doing and looked at him.
"Your mother... passed away?" She asked tentatively.
The little boy shook his head, "I don't know either. I was raised by my grandfather. If my grandfather didn't tell me, I wouldn't dare to ask."
Ping'er was stunned, not knowing what to say.
This child is really pitiful...
On the other hand, Hua Hua, like a little grown-up, patted the little boy's little hand lightly: "Little brother, don't be sad, at least you still have grandpa who loves you, my grandpa and my father died a long time ago, my mother is here, but My mother doesn't want me anymore, I lived with Aunt Ping'er..."
Hearing this, the little boy looked at Ping'er again in surprise.
So they are not mother and daughter?
Earlier at the steamed stuffed bun shop, he was attracted by the picture of the two of them warmly feeding.
(End of this chapter)
